Roasted a chicken last night. Accompanied by roast veg (spud, sweet spud, parsnip and carrot) and steamed brocolli, cauliflower and some cabbage. Home made stuffing and gravy. Aside from stuffing and some meat for sandwiches, all leftovers, including the gravy and water from cooking the veg went into a pot. Two hours later and an immense chicken soup was made.

Eaten tonight for dinner with some surprisingly nice brown bread from M&S. Fucking delicious, better than the roast dinner last night, and that was really good too. Something perfect about a really hefty soup when it is cold and miserable outsideā€¦
